The Core Wix Cost: Platform Pricing & Essential Fees
The foundation of your Wix website cost is the platform subscription. Wix offers several tiers, each unlocking different features essential for a serious business.
Choosing the wrong tier is a common mistake that leads to unexpected upgrade costs down the line. We focus on the annual billing rates, which offer the best value, but remember that monthly billing is significantly higher.
Wix Premium Plan Tiers (Approximate Annual Rates)
| Plan Tier | Approx. Monthly Cost (Billed Annually) | Best For | Key Features/Limitations |
|---|---|---|---|
| Light | $17/month | Personal/Simple Brochure Sites | Removes Wix Ads, Custom Domain (1st year free), 2GB Storage. No eCommerce. |
| Core | $29/month | Small Businesses/Basic eCommerce | 50GB Storage, Basic eCommerce features (accept payments), Basic Analytics. |
| Business | $36/month | Growing Online Stores | 100GB Storage, Advanced eCommerce (subscriptions, automated sales tax), More Collaborators. |
| Business Elite | $159/month | Enterprise-Level eCommerce | Unlimited Storage, Priority VIP Support, Full Advanced Marketing Suite. |
| Enterprise | Custom Pricing | Global Brands/Large Organizations | Tailored solutions, dedicated account management, and specialized features. |
Essential Annual Fees Beyond the Subscription:
- Domain Renewal: The free domain is only for the first year. Renewal typically costs between $15 and $21 per year.
- Premium Apps: While the Wix App Market has free options, essential business functionality (advanced booking, complex forms, specific integrations) often requires a premium app, costing an additional $3 to $50 per month.
- Email Hosting: Professional email (e.g., Google Workspace) is an add-on, typically $6-$12/month per mailbox.

Option 1: The DIY Approach (The Time-Cost Trap)
Cost Range: $200 - $1,000 (Annual Platform Fees + Domain)
This is the cheapest option in terms of cash outlay. However, it carries the highest risk and opportunity cost. Your time, as an executive or founder, is the most expensive resource.
Spending 80-150 hours learning the editor, battling with responsive design, and trying to optimize for SEO is a poor allocation of capital. The result is often a site with a low conversion rate, which is the ultimate hidden cost.
Option 2: The Freelancer Route (The Quality-Risk Trade-off)
Cost Range: $1,500 - $5,000 (One-time Design Fee)
Hiring a freelancer is a step up. They can provide a professional aesthetic and save you significant time. However, quality and reliability are highly inconsistent.
You risk scope creep, communication issues, and a lack of process maturity. If the freelancer disappears or lacks deep expertise in conversion rate optimization (CRO) or complex Velo by Wix customization, you are left with a beautiful but non-functional site.

The Hidden Costs of a Wix Website You Must Budget For
As a global tech staffing strategist, we advise our clients to look beyond the sticker price. The true cost of a Wix website often lies in the 'hidden' or unexpected fees that impact your long-term budget and ROI.
Ignoring these can lead to a budget overrun of 15% to 30%.
- Renewal Price Hikes: Wix, like many builders, offers steep introductory discounts. Expect your annual subscription cost to increase significantly-sometimes doubling or tripling-upon renewal after the first year.
- Transaction Fees: If you run an eCommerce store, Wix Payments charges a processing fee (typically 2.9% + $0.30 per transaction). This is a recurring, volume-based cost that must be factored into your gross margin.
- Velo Customization: When you hit the limits of the drag-and-drop editor and need custom functionality (e.g., complex database interactions, custom APIs), you need a developer skilled in Velo by Wix. This specialized labor is more expensive than basic design work.
- Maintenance and Updates: While Wix handles hosting, you still need to budget for content updates, security monitoring, and regular CRO adjustments. A dedicated maintenance plan can cost $500 to $2,000+ annually, depending on complexity.
- Opportunity Cost of Poor SEO: A poorly structured, non-optimized DIY site will fail to rank. The cost here is the lost revenue from organic traffic. Frequently Asked Questions
Is Wix cheaper than WordPress for web design?
Wix is generally cheaper for the initial setup and basic maintenance because hosting, security (SSL), and the builder are bundled into one subscription.
WordPress, while free software, requires separate costs for hosting, premium themes/plugins, and often more complex maintenance. For a simple, non-custom site, Wix is often cheaper. For a highly custom, scalable enterprise solution, a custom WordPress or other full-stack solution may offer better long-term ROI, despite a higher initial cost.
